Abstract

The utility model discloses a kind of capsule class weighing products devices, including rack, feeding device, lifting material holding tray, running gear, electrostatic adsorption device, weighing unit, ash can and finished product box, feeding device is mounted on the rack, feeding device discharge port can face go up and down material holding tray, material holding tray is gone up and down to connect on the rack by running gear, weighing unit be mounted on the rack and can face lifting material holding tray, ash can and finished product box are mounted side by side below rack and the capsule of electrostatic adsorption device absorption can be fallen into wherein.The utility model can carry out weighing sorting to capsule, and whole process can eliminate manually-operated contact stain, and detection efficiency is high, and error is small.

用胶囊装的药物,一般都是对食道和胃粘膜有刺激性的粉末或颗粒,口感不好、易于挥发、在口腔中易被唾液分解,以及易吸入气管的药。在胶囊的制造过程中会经过多道工序,不可避免地会产生一些内部含有杂质、囊体缺口、裂缝、花头等不合格的胶囊,在生产的过程中还存在胶囊内部的药粉颗粒含量不足的现象,不符合规定的胶囊包含的药粉颗粒含量不足,甚至出现空心胶囊。含量不足的次品胶囊的存在严重的影响了胶囊生产厂家的声誉,而且这些次品胶囊通过市场流到消费者的手中将会给消费者带来不必要的损失,并可能耽误消费者的服药进程,所以需要对胶囊进行检测。在市场中已经出现通过摄像装置来进行实时监控的器械,但检测灯的灯光强弱需要通过人工动手调节,才能达到检测环境的理想化。目前,大部分胶囊生产企业都采用人工目选与手工挑选相结合的胶囊检测方法,但是,这种工作方式检测效率低,成本高,劳动强度大,检查人员肉眼长时间对着灯光,眼睛的疲劳对检查结果会产生很大的影响,容易产生漏检,次品的检出率低,质量不稳定,目前保健、医药对环境及材料的卫生要求都很高,人手直接接触到胶囊或胶囊制剂,不可避免的产生了对胶囊或胶囊制剂的污染。人工筛检方式效率低、成本高、存在漏拣、错拣现象的缺陷,即使有辅助设备,也存在诸多不便,自动检测胶囊,尤其是在线自动检测胶囊的设备以及技术较少公开。Medicines in capsules are generally powders or granules that are irritating to the esophagus and gastric mucosa, have a bad taste, are easily volatile, are easily decomposed by saliva in the mouth, and are easily inhaled into the trachea. In the manufacturing process of capsules, there will be multiple processes, and some unqualified capsules containing impurities, capsule body gaps, cracks, flower heads, etc. will inevitably be produced. During the production process, there are still insufficient powder particles in the capsules. Phenomenon, the capsules that do not meet the regulations contain insufficient powder particles, and even hollow capsules appear. The existence of defective capsules with insufficient content has seriously affected the reputation of capsule manufacturers, and the flow of these defective capsules into the hands of consumers through the market will bring unnecessary losses to consumers and may delay consumers' taking medicines. process, so the capsule needs to be detected. In the market, there have been devices for real-time monitoring through camera devices, but the light intensity of the detection lamp needs to be manually adjusted to achieve the ideal detection environment. At present, most capsule manufacturers adopt the capsule detection method combining manual visual selection and manual selection. However, this method of detection has low detection efficiency, high cost and high labor intensity. Fatigue will have a great impact on inspection results, it is easy to miss inspection, the detection rate of defective products is low, and the quality is unstable. At present, health care and medicine have high hygienic requirements on the environment and materials, and human hands directly touch capsules or capsules. preparations, inevitably resulting in contamination of capsules or capsule preparations. The manual screening method has low efficiency, high cost, and the defects of missing and wrong picking. Even if there are auxiliary equipment, there are still many inconveniences. The automatic detection of capsules, especially the equipment and technology of automatic detection of capsules online, is less public.

本实用新型通过将胶囊置于储料桶2内,在分料电机3的带动下旋转,旋转的叶片加上呈圆台状的分料转位盘1底座可使胶囊持续流出,流出的胶囊进入分料槽6,由于分料槽6的出料口7小而进料口5大可使胶囊进行预排列,出料口7处的间歇机构8可在升降盛料盘9抵达出料口7处时打开阀口通道,离开时关闭。盛满胶囊的升降盛料盘9在行走装置的带动下可进行往复运动,抵达称重台25时,升降盛料盘9可在升降电机11的驱动下在齿轮齿条机构12上作上下运动,升降盛料盘9下行与重量传感器24接触,由于重量传感器24呈凸台状而盛料斗10呈与之相反的反凸台状,当升降盛料盘9继续下行,置于盛料斗10内的活动片31可被重量传感器24顶起实现对活动片31上的胶囊称重,此时若有次品,可在废料吸附板19的吸取下剔除,次品胶囊在吸料电机17的带动下通过吸料轮16在导轨15上移动至废料箱13开口上方,此时解除静电吸附而让胶囊落入废料箱13,同样成品由成品吸附板20吸取,再在导轨15上移动至成品箱14上方,解除静电吸附落入成品箱14。空的升降盛料盘9再在行走装置的带动下回到出料口7处,此时间歇机构8打开通道流出胶囊实现整个工作循环。分料转位盘、分料槽可以对胶囊进行预排列,方便盛料斗对胶囊进行一一盛取,行走装置与间歇机构配合可以方便地将盛料斗内的胶囊送到称重台进行检测,升降盛料盘与称重平台上的重量传感器配合可以快速称取胶囊的重量,同时废料吸附板可将重量不合格的次品吸取剔除,再由成品吸附板吸取合格品,从而将合格品与次品分别装进成品箱和废料箱。本实用新型能够对胶囊进行称重分拣,整个过程完全自动化进行,免去了人工操作的接触污染,检测效率高,误差小,利于生产中的推广应用。In the utility model, the capsules are placed in the storage bucket 2 and rotated under the driving of the material distribution motor 3. The rotating blades and the base of the material distribution indexing plate 1 in the shape of a circular cone can make the capsules flow out continuously, and the outflowing capsules enter the In the distributing chute 6, because the discharging port 7 of the distributing chute 6 is small and the feeding port 5 is large, the capsules can be pre-arranged, and the intermittent mechanism 8 at the discharging port 7 can reach the discharging port 7 in the lifting and lowering tray 9. The valve port channel is opened when the valve is left, and closed when it is left. The lifting tray 9 filled with capsules can reciprocate under the driving of the traveling device. When reaching the weighing platform 25, the lifting tray 9 can move up and down on the rack and pinion mechanism 12 under the drive of the lifting motor 11. , the lifting tray 9 descends and contacts with the weight sensor 24. Since the weight sensor 24 is in the shape of a boss, and the hopper 10 is in the shape of an inverse boss, when the lifting tray 9 continues to descend, it is placed in the hopper 10. The movable piece 31 can be lifted by the weight sensor 24 to realize the weighing of the capsules on the movable piece 31. At this time, if there are defective products, they can be removed under the suction of the waste adsorption plate 19, and the defective capsules are driven by the suction motor 17. Next, the suction wheel 16 moves on the guide rail 15 to the top of the opening of the waste box 13. At this time, the electrostatic adsorption is released and the capsules fall into the waste box 13. Similarly, the finished product is sucked by the finished product suction plate 20, and then moved on the guide rail 15 to the finished product box. Above 14 , the electrostatic adsorption is released and it falls into the finished product box 14 . The empty lifting and holding tray 9 is then driven back to the discharge port 7 by the traveling device. At this time, the intermittent mechanism 8 opens the channel and flows out of the capsule to realize the entire working cycle. The distributing indexing plate and the distributing trough can pre-arrange the capsules, which is convenient for the hopper to take the capsules one by one. The traveling device and the intermittent mechanism can conveniently send the capsules in the hopper to the weighing platform for testing. The lifting tray and the weight sensor on the weighing platform can quickly weigh the weight of the capsules. At the same time, the waste adsorption plate can absorb and reject the defective products with unqualified weight, and then the qualified products are absorbed by the finished product adsorption plate, so as to combine the qualified products with the qualified products. The defective products are put into the finished product box and the waste box respectively. The utility model can weigh and sort the capsules, the whole process is completely automated, the contact pollution of manual operation is avoided, the detection efficiency is high, the error is small, and the popularization and application in production are favorable.
